Overview of the Columbus P-10 Pro Data Logger

The Columbus P-10 Pro Data Logger is a professional GNSS device designed for accurate and reliable data acquisition․ It supports dual-frequency positioning (L1 and L5 bands) and multi-constellation reception (GPS‚ Galileo‚ GLONASS)‚ ensuring enhanced accuracy․ The device features three operating modes: Normal‚ Motion Detection‚ and SpyTracking‚ catering to various tracking needs․ Its compact‚ lightweight‚ and weatherproof design makes it suitable for diverse environments․ The P-10 Pro offers high-quality data collection‚ internal memory‚ and microSD card support‚ with compatibility for multiple data formats and communication protocols․ This versatile logger is ideal for surveying‚ asset tracking‚ and scientific research‚ providing precise location data for informed decision-making․

Dual-Frequency Positioning Technology (L1 and L5 Bands)

The Columbus P-10 Pro utilizes advanced dual-frequency positioning technology‚ operating on both L1 and L5 bands․ This innovative approach enhances positioning accuracy by up to five times compared to single-frequency systems․ By combining signals from both bands‚ the P-10 Pro mitigates ionospheric interference and multipath effects‚ delivering precise location data even in challenging environments․ The L1 band ensures compatibility with existing GPS infrastructure‚ while the L5 band provides higher accuracy and better performance in urban canyons and under tree cover․ This dual-frequency capability makes the P-10 Pro ideal for applications requiring lane-level accuracy‚ such as surveying‚ mapping‚ and autonomous systems․ Its robust signal processing ensures reliable tracking in diverse conditions․

Operating Modes: Normal‚ Motion Detection‚ and SpyTracking

The Columbus P-10 Pro offers three operating modes tailored to specific tracking needs․ Normal Mode provides continuous data logging‚ ideal for consistent tracking scenarios like vehicle monitoring․ Motion Detection Mode activates logging only when movement is detected‚ conserving power for stationary or intermittent events․ SpyTracking Mode prioritizes extended battery life‚ enabling ultra-long recording sessions with minimal power consumption․ These modes ensure flexibility‚ allowing users to optimize data acquisition based on their application requirements․ Whether for continuous‚ event-based‚ or discreet tracking‚ the P-10 Pro adapts seamlessly‚ delivering reliable performance across diverse environments and use cases․

Common Issues and Solutions

Common issues with the Columbus P-10 Pro include GNSS signal loss‚ battery drain‚ and data format errors․ GNSS signal loss can occur in areas with poor satellite visibility‚ such as indoors or under heavy tree cover․ To resolve this‚ ensure the device has a clear view of the sky․ Battery drain can be addressed by adjusting power settings or using SpyTracking Mode․ Data format errors may arise if settings are misconfigured; ensure the correct format is selected for your application․ Regular firmware updates and proper calibration can prevent many issues․ Refer to the manual for detailed troubleshooting steps․
